Greenville, SC, United States
The Cline Company has provided engineered solutions and quality products to the paper, steel, marine and general industrial markets for over 50 years. Our success has been accomplished by the Cline Company's design, manufacture, and distribution of universal shafts, gear couplings, metal couplings, fluid couplings, clutches, brakes, friction material, seal strips, and other products for industry provided out of a customer service-driven mentality. Founded in 1948, the Cline Company currently operates out of a 60,000 square feet manufacturing facility in Greenville, South Carolina, and is staffed by 60 employees committed to providing superior products and customer service. Vouliagmeni, Greece
Thenamaris Ships Management is a Greek ship management company founded in 1972, managing a diverse fleet of approximately 90 vessels including tankers, bulk carriers, containerships, LNG and LPG carriers, with over 3,800 seafarers and 300 shore-based employees, providing integrated ship management and commercial services.
